TK99’s Blues, Brews and BBQ becomes free event
By Mark Bialczak, The Post-Standard
There’s a new twist on a Memorial Day Weekend favorite in Central New York.
The folks at Syracuse rock radio station TK99 announced this morning that the annual Blues, Brew and BBQ will be a free-admission event, on May 29 at the state fairgrounds’ Chevy Court in Geddes.
Headliners will be Max Weinberg and his big band, and Southside Johnny and the Asbury Jukes.

The lineup also will include guitarist Coco Montoya, former band mate of John Mayall, and Syracuse’s The Fabulous Ripcords. Two more Syracuse bands will be announced, likely to be Super DeLinquents and The Chris Terra Band.
The doors will open at 2 p.m., and the music will start at 3 p.m.
Last year, Kenny Wayne Shepherd headlined, and the ticket cost $20 in advance or $25 at the gate.
